Listen guys I loved that jeep but no doubt I just got a bad one . My girlfriend In Burlingame also bought a 2020 Gladiator and has had no trouble with it at all . However I've read some nightmare stories on this forum From Wrangler and Gladiator owners . One Gladiator owner who lived a block and a half from the dealership had the same problem as me . He took it back 10 times and the dealer finally offered him a new one which he accepted much to his wife's disapproval . But I understand , everything about the Gladiators mechanically and cosmetically is awesome except for a bad software issue and the electric power steering motor that will over heat if you put bigger tires on it which I have never done. A friend of mine who owns DC Customs in Ukiah California has converted Nine of the Gladiators and other Jeeps back to the belt drive power steering pump kits . It used to cost $4,500 but it probably cost about $5,000 now out the door. Its a forever cure for the power steering issues if you don't mind spending Five grand . I told Jeep about this fix but they never offered to pay for it. Don...
